Pulaski Yankees to open gates at 4 pm for remainder of 2019 season

Change to take effect with next home game on Thursday June 27
The Pulaski Yankees today announced they will open gates at 4 pm for all remaining games at Motor Mile Field at Calfee Park for the 2019 season. Fans looking to take advantage of the new early entry time must have a paid ticket to that night’s game.

“We believe this will enhance our fan experience by offering folks a chance to watch both our team and the visiting team take batting practice,” said Pulaski Yankees General Manager Betsy Haugh. “This is becoming more and more common at the Major League level, and we think our fans will be excited to catch early action at Calfee Park this summer.”

Concessions windows and select kiosks will be open at 4 pm, with all additional concession stands opening by 5:30pm.

“From the renovated concourse to new additions such as cornhole and inflatables, there is a lot for fans to enjoy at Calfee Park, and we look forward to opening gates earlier to give our fans more time to enjoy a summer afternoon/evening at the ballpark,” Haugh said.
